- [ ] **Step 7: Breaker override escrow.** After sealing the signing keys for the Tallgrove upstream API circuit breaker, confirm the support team can force the breaker open during a full outage. The override bundle lives in the sealed escrow drawer and is useless without its unlock phrase. Two ceremony witnesses must initial this step before proceeding. The escrow bundle is decrypted with the recovery passphrase that follows.

vault phrase of kahip-kahop = holath-quenmir

Action item from the Fernspire outage: the quotelookup service logged every cache miss at INFO, flooding the aggregator and masking the real errors. Owner: on-call. Switch it to probabilistic sampling with a burst allowance, keep ERROR unsampled, and alert if sampled volume still exceeds the aggregator quota. Ship behind the existing logging flag. Apply the sampling constants exactly as listed below.

tuning table, yajog-yahof:
BUDGETS = {
    "lamvan": 303,
    "wenox": 460,
    "fenvan": 525,
}

## Deploying the Gatewick Proctor Queue

Deploys are pretty painless: push to main, wait for the pipeline, then watch the queue drain dashboard for five minutes. If candidates pile up mid-exam, roll back first and ask questions later — the queue replays safely. Everything the workers care about lives in one config block, shown here for reference.

settings of bafof-yagef:
JOROX_PIN=8740
JOROX_TENANT=pelox
JOROX_METRICS_HOST=metrics.jorox.qorvelworks.internal
JOROX_SEAL=seal_c78f63c1
JOROX_STANDBY_TEAM=norax

## Idempotency Keys for Payment Retries (Lumopay)

Every retry of a charge request must reuse the original idempotency key; generating a new key on retry can produce duplicate charges. Keys are scoped per merchant and expire after 48 hours. Reviewers should verify keys are derived server-side, never from client input. The full key-generation specification and threat model are maintained on the internal page.

dashboard of kaguf-tawip = https://vault.merlaqsys.test/issue